Automatic CRD Upgrades in VirtRigaud Helm Chart¶
Overview¶
VirtRigaud Helm chart now supports automatic CRD upgrades during helm upgrade. This eliminates the need for manual CRD management and provides a seamless upgrade experience.
The Problem¶
By default, Helm has a limitation: - CRDs are installed during helm install - CRDs are NOT upgraded during helm upgrade
This means users had to manually apply CRD updates before upgrading, which was: - Error-prone - Easy to forget - Breaks GitOps workflows - Causes version drift between chart and CRDs
The Solution¶
VirtRigaud uses Helm Hooks with a Kubernetes Job to automatically apply CRDs during both install and upgrade:

How It Works¶
- Pre-Upgrade Hook: Before the main upgrade starts, a Job is created
- CRD Application: The Job applies all CRDs using
kubectl apply --server-side - Safe Upgrades: Server-side apply handles conflicts gracefully
- Automatic Cleanup: Job is deleted after successful completion

Server-Side Apply¶
Uses kubectl apply --server-side for: - Safe conflict resolution - Field management - No ownership conflicts
GitOps Compatible¶
Works seamlessly with: - ArgoCD: Helm hooks execute properly - Flux: Compatible with HelmRelease CRD upgrades - Terraform: Helm provider handles hooks

Technical Details¶
Hook Weights¶
The upgrade process uses weighted hooks for proper ordering:
| Weight | Resource | Purpose |
|---|---|---|
-10 | ConfigMap | Store CRD content |
-5 | RBAC | Create permissions |
0 | Job | Apply CRDs |

FAQ¶
Q: Will this delete my existing resources?¶
A: No. CRD upgrades are additive and preserve existing Custom Resources.
Q: What happens if the job fails?¶
A: Helm upgrade will fail, leaving your cluster in the previous state. Fix the issue and retry.
Q: Can I use this with ArgoCD?¶
A: Yes! ArgoCD properly executes Helm hooks.
Q: Does this work with Flux?¶
A: Yes! Flux HelmRelease handles hooks correctly.
Q: How do I roll back?¶
A: Use helm rollback. CRDs are not rolled back (Kubernetes limitation).
